study tips for olevels? by laaadadadaa in SGExams

[–]SubstantialGroup3661 0 points1 point  (0 children)

  1. science: get ur foundation right first, don't just memorise ur tb for the sake of memorising. u need to understand what ur memorising! also some topics will definitely link with others so u need to be open to questions that has cross topics, u can practise them through school test papers etc. u can create a book for all the mistakes u have done, there's always repeated/common questions from the past that may come out again for ur olvls! so if u get them wrong just write it down on ur book and make sure u get them right next time! please score well for ur mcq because it's really important. there will def be repeated qns for ur mcq so make sure u get ur mcqs correctly! math: again u need to set ur foundation, this is really important! u can do ur tb qns (start from blue to yellow and if ur confident enough do red) and also other schools test papers. it's impt u finish ur tys also because again there might be repeated qns from the past. keep on practicing ur math questions and always make sure u understand ur mistakes!
  2. there's always a format for all ur qns in hist & ss, the most important format is ur purpose qns! ur school shld provide u with answering formats, but if not u can dm me for the answering formats! essay u really just need to memorise it and u will definitely score, always give 3 factors at least + a conclusion to score well! make sure that u make the factors clear and give a great example + exp for it!
  3. start getting consultation now, u can start grinding ur tys during ur june hols. make sure u finish most of ur tys during june hols and go thru the mistakes u have made. u should get all ur concepts before doing ur tys btw so dont start doing it if u havent memorised or study anything, do the papers at one go
  4. we don't use bellcurve but more of moderation! if ur consistently getting A1 for ur english then sure ur most likely to get A1-A2 in olvls! english usually has a lower moderation meaning most people fall in the B3-B4 range, so its easier for u to get ur A1! but if the paper is really easy or manageable then u have to be careful because the moderation will def be higher and reduces ur chance.. but dont worry, as long as u study hard u will still get ur As!

[deleted by user] by [deleted] in SGExams

[–]SubstantialGroup3661 0 points1 point  (0 children)

emath: set ur foundation first, make sure u get all the basics right for each topic then u work ur way up. do ur tb exercise qns (esp the yellow coded qns) , grind ur emath tys + other school test pprs. there will be qns that can come out from previous years. go through ur mistakes and make sure u dont get them wrong again , i have some emath notes if u need!

chem: dont just memorise it, understand what ur memorising. slowly take in the content and eventually u will get the topics! take note of cross topics too, meaning that some topics will actually intervene each other and they will def come out for olvls (e.g ch 3+4+5 can be mixed tgt as a question) and pls pls PLS do ur tys for this one cause theres is a 99% spawn chance rhere will be qns from prev years esp in ur mcq

history + ss: i personally did not study much yet got an a1, so dont bother studying like 5h on the subject or smt.. u must know ALL the questions types (e.g, purpose qns, inference..) make sure u know their answering format too, ESP purpose para that qn type is bound to come out for alm every qns type. i suggest u shld know surprise + proving qns well because they are most likely to come out this yr since last year it didnt came out. and for essays u pretty much need to memorise only, dont cramp it for the last few days else u wont rmb anything. space it out , usually short chapters take abt 1-2 days to memo, long ones are 3-4 days
